ICSA Chartered Secretaries Qualifying Scheme (CSQS) Fast Track


Students accepted by ICSA onto the Fast Track programme only need to sit two exams in order to qualify. Once you have achieved GradICSA status you can immediately apply for full Membership (ACIS) and become a Chartered Secretary.


The subjects you must take are:  Corporate Secretarial Practice and Chartered Secretaries Case Study

Am I eligible for the Fast Track Scheme? To be eligible you must be a fully-qualified and current member of one of the following major accountancy bodies:

  • The Institute of Chartered Accountants in England and Wales (ICAEW)

  • The Institute of Chartered Accountants of Scotland (ICAS)

  • The Institute of Chartered Accountants in Ireland (ICAI)

  • The Association of Chartered Certified Accountants (ACCA)

  • The Chartered Institute of Management Accountants (CIMA)

  • The Chartered Institute of Public Finance and Accountancy (CIPFA)

Or you must be a fully qualified lawyer and current member of the Law Society or compliant with the Qualified Lawyers Transfer Regulations.You must also have a minimum of five years' professional experience. Appropriate experience would include:

  • Company secretarial and legal work

  • Corporate governance

  • Financial management

  • Committee administration and accounting

  • General management and administration

  • Pensions

  • Insurance

You will need to send your full CV with your current job description along with your application to ICSA so that they may assess the suitability of your experience. Once you are sure you will be accepted, you may start on a course of study with us.

ICSA fee: There is a special package price for this scheme of £1,275 payable to ICSA. This package price includes a non-refundable registration fee, a one year annual subscription fee, exemption fees and one exam entry for both of the applicable modules. Campbell's fees are additional to this.
